The catalytic activity of transition metals and their compounds is mainly due to: a)their magnetic behaviour b)their unfilled d-orbitals c)their ability to adopt variable oxidation state d)their chemical reactivity

A

Their manetic behaviour

B

Their unfilled d-orbitals

C

their ability to adopt variable oxidation state

D

their chemical reactivity

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
C

Because of the variable oxidation states they may form intermediate compound with one of the reactants. These intermediate provides a new path with lower activation energy.
` V_2O_5 +SO_2 to V_2 O_4 + SO_3 , 2V_2O_4 to 2 V_2 O_5`
